The Accounts Receivable Management (ARM) Division manages delinquent Personal Income Tax and Bank and Corporation Income Tax debts as well as Non‑Tax debts. Our collection approach is founded on the principle that we use the least intrusive action first to gain compliance. Our collection strategy is to encourage taxpayers to resolve their debts as quickly as possible through the method best suited for their situation to help them achieve long term compliance.

In addition to income tax liabilities, we collect non-tax related debts owed to state and local governments when they are referred to us by statute.
